NTE74HCT08 Description
The NTE74HCT08 is a high-performance, 4-channel AND gate IC designed for a wide range of digital logic applications. Manufactured by NTE Electronics, Inc., this logic IC chip is part of the 74HCT series and is housed in a through-hole package, making it suitable for both prototyping and production environments. The NTE74HCT08 operates within a supply voltage range of 4.5V to 5.5V and features a maximum propagation delay of 18ns at 5V with a 50pF load, ensuring fast and reliable signal processing.
Each of the four AND gates in the NTE74HCT08 has two inputs, allowing for complex logic functions to be implemented with minimal components. The input logic levels are well-defined, with a low level at 0.8V and a high level at 2V, ensuring compatibility with a variety of digital systems. The IC also boasts a low quiescent current of 20 µA, making it energy-efficient for battery-powered and low-power applications.
The NTE74HCT08 is packaged in a bag, making it easy to handle and store. is It also RoHS3 compliant, ensuring it meets the latest environmental standards for electronic components. With a maximum output current of 4.8mA for both high and low states, the NTE74HCT08 can drive a variety of loads, making it versatile for different applications.
